Contents Saint Patrick's Letter to the Soldiers of Coroticus -- Saint Patrick's Confession -- The Synod of Saint Patrick -- The Hymns of Saint Secundinus -- Saint Patrick's Breastplate -- Muirchu's Life of Saint Patrick -- The Life of Saint Brigid -- The Voyage of Saint Brendan
Summary The real story of Patrick and his times is even better than the tales that have grown up around him. 'The World of Saint Patrick' brings together for the first time the greatest and most important works of early Christian Ireland in a fresh, vibrant translation for general readers. It also includes a collection of early church laws, imaginative tales of Patrick's struggles with pagan kings, soaring hymns of praise, and a prayer of protection against forces of evil, including 'the magic of women, blacksmiths, and druids'
